What are the commonly used standards in mechanical design manuals
The mechanical design manual contains various commonly used standards aimed at ensuring the safety and reliability of products, ensuring the safety, efficiency, and
reliability of mechanical product design and manufacturing. The commonly used standards in mechanical design manuals cover a wide range of design and manuf--
acturing aspects, including but not limited to:
1. Basic information and formulas: including commonly used information and data, letters, domestic standard codes and national standard codes of various countries,
mechanical transmission efficiency, density of commonly used materials, elastic modulus and Poisson's ratio of materials, friction coefficient, melting point, thermal
conductivity and specific heat capacity of metal materials, linear expansion coefficient of materials, physical properties of liquid materials, physical properties of gas
materials, etc.
2. Conversion between legal units of measurement and commonly used units: Provides conversion between legal units of measurement and commonly used units to
ensure standardization and internationalization of design.
3. Material data: including elastic modulus and Poisson's ratio of commonly used materials, melting point, thermal conductivity and specific heat capacity of metal
materials, linear expansion coefficient of materials, density of commonly used materials, approximate relationship of ultimate strength of commonly used materials,
hardness and strength conversion of steel (black metal), etc.
4. Friction coefficient: Provides the sliding friction coefficient, rolling friction coefficient, and friction coefficient of commonly used materials, which is very important
for considering friction and wear in mechanical design.
5. Mechanical efficiency and transmission ratios of various transmissions: including approximate efficiency values of mechanical transmissions and friction pairs, tr-
ansmission ratios of various transmissions, which are crucial for ensuring the efficiency and performance of mechanical equipment.
In addition, the mechanical design manual also includes design information for various mechanical components such as bearings, gears, connectors, as well as design
information for hydraulic and pneumatic transmission systems. These contents provide comprehensive design guidance and references for mechanical designers, he-
lping them design and manufacture mechanical products that meet standards and requirements.
